Business Support Officer (PA to Social Worker)

Job Introduction

Our Fostering Business Support team are key to the success of our Fostering Service because our Business Support teams are there, making sure things run smoothly, so that our frontline colleagues can deliver for children and families in the community. All that work in the background doesn’t just happen, it takes dedicated colleagues, taking pride in their work and seeing a purpose in the work they are doing.

We have an opportunity for a 22.5 hour Business Support Officer (PA to Social Worker).

This is a permanent position.

The hours of work are Monday- Wednesday 08:30 - 17:00.

You will be predominantly office based, although some home working is arranged on a rota basis dependant on the demands of the service.  

Main Responsibility

Tasks will include:

  • Supporting Social Workers as a first point of contact
  • In support of Social Workers statutory workload, convene and attend meetings, including statutory multi agency meetings, coordinating the circulation of agenda and papers and taking and distributing appropriate notes, minutes and actions.
  • Completing a range of admin tasks ensuring compliance with business processes and service level agreements
  • Accurately input and maintain information systems in support of Social Workers ensuring that records are up to date

You will make full use of the Department’s IT facilities including accurately maintaining, monitoring and analysing data.

The Ideal Candidate

You will have:

  • IT Qualification (ICDL Advanced (L3) or equivalent) 
  • NVQ Level 3  in Business Administration or equivalent experience
  • Good written and oral communication skills 
  • Experience of using Microsoft Office 365 and computer-based information systems in an office environment 
  • The ability to work independently, with minimal supervision.
